Multiple File
As shown in the above image of that we have to upload 3 files but that should be of different sections EMD,PAN,AADHAR and if we use the .multiple() the at a time we can select multiple file for only one field, but to do for different fields we shoud use .any(), In this you can type any number of file paths.
const upload_PAN = multer({
storage: multer.diskStorage({
destination: function (req, file, cb) {
cb(null, "uploads_tender")
},
filename: function (req, file, cb) {
let name = file.originalname;
cb(null, file.fieldname + "_" + Date.now() + ".pdf")
}
})
}).any('PAN_file', 'EMD_file', 'Aadhar_file')
Single File
To upload for single file only one thing we have to change
i.e.,
const upload_PAN = multer({
storage: multer.diskStorage({
destination: function (req, file, cb) {
cb(null, "uploads_tender")
},
filename: function (req, file, cb) {
let name = file.originalname;
cb(null, file.fieldname + "_" + Date.now() + ".pdf")
}
})
}).single('Aadhar_file')
